The Current Legal Drinking Age in India

First foremost, let`s understand The Current Legal Drinking Age in India. As of now, the legal drinking age varies from state to state, with most states setting the minimum age at 21 years. However, there are a few exceptions, such as Goa and Sikkim, where the legal drinking age is 18 years.

Comparison of Legal Drinking Ages Across Indian States

State Legal Drinking Age
Delhi 25 years
Maharashtra 25 years
Goa 18 years
Madhya Pradesh 21 years
Andhra Pradesh 21 years

It`s interesting to note the significant variations in the legal drinking age across different states in India. This disparity raises questions about the effectiveness and consistency of our alcohol regulations.
